W Volleyball: Stunned in Five Set Thriller to Comets

Huntington Beach, Calif. - Golden West came out and dominated the first two sets of the match but winning the third set proved difficult as they fell to Palomar in a five set thriller 25-11, 25-13, 20-25, 26-28, and 18-20. 

The first two sets the Rustlers hit .320 and .360 with minimal mistakes and looked poised to finish off a 3-0 sweep at home until the Comets got hot late in the third set. The momentum shifted with each rally in the fourth set as both teams battled leading to a Palomar set win 28-26 to set up a tension gripping fifth set. 

Golden West would take an early 5-2 lead in the fifth set forcing the Comets to take their first timeout. The Rustlers found themselves behind 9-7 before head coach Bill Lawler used his first timeout to refocus, which proved fruitful as the Rustlers would take a 14-13 lead. Unfortunately, Golden West couldn't close it out and fell 20-18 in the decisive fifth set. 

Sophomore Adriana Morales led the Rustlers with 19 kills on the night and freshman Maci Hendry tallied 13 kills. 

Golden West will open Orange Empire Conference play on Friday as they are set to host Santa Ana College at 6pm.
